Choosing between a government job and a private job after graduating with a BCom from Allahabad University depends on your career goals, interests, and lifestyle preferences. Government jobs offer high job security, fixed working hours, and attractive benefits like pensions and healthcare, but they often require passing competitive exams and may have slower career progression and a rigid work environment. On the other hand, private sector jobs typically offer higher salary potential, faster career growth, and a dynamic work environment, but come with less job security, longer working hours, and higher stress levels. To make an informed decision, consider your priorities regarding stability versus growth, work environment preferences, and career aspirations. Additionally, researching job roles, talking to professionals in both sectors, and gaining practical experience through internships can provide valuable insights. Ultimately, your choice should align with your personal goals and what you envision for your future career.

The TNEA document verification process is not online. You'll need to visit a designated TNEA Facilitation Centre (TFC) to have your documents verified in person. You have already uploaded the documents you have available (as of today, June 12, 2024) which is great. After uploading the documents, you will need to visit a TFC as per the schedule provided by the DoTE, Tamil Nadu. This typically happens between the application closing date and the rank list declaration. At the TFC, officials will verify the originals of the documents you uploaded online, including your certificates from 8th to 12th standard (if available by then). Since today is the last day for uploading documents, and you haven't received your certificates yet: Try contacting your school as soon as possible to inquire about the status of your certificates and the expected date of issuance. Explain your situation regarding TNEA document verification. If you have any other supporting documents related to your 8th to 12th studies (like mark sheets, transfer certificates, etc.), upload them during the online window. If your certificates are still not ready by the time of your TFC visit, try to get a written statement from your school explaining the delay and confirming your academic record. You can apply for the OBC certificate from Kota, Rajasthan as long as you are currently residing in Rajasthan. In Rajasthan, eligibility for obtaining a caste certificate is based on your current residence in the state, not your birthplace or schooling location.
Look for the office of the Tehsildar (revenue officer) in Kota. They are typically responsible for issuing caste certificates.The Rajasthan government website or local authorities might have information on the online application process (if available). The process of admission in AIIMS, Delhi is different for different course. For MBBS, candidates must have the required eligibility criteria and clear the NEET examination with valid scores. For B.Sc courses, candidates with the required eligibility criteria have to apply and appear for an entrance exam conducted by AIIMS Delhi. Admission is given on the basis of the marks scored in the entrance examination. To get admission in M.D/M.S/M.Sc/M.D.S course, students must fulfill the eligibility criteria and appear for the INI CET conducted by AIIMS Delhi.
